KEEP UP WITH LATE VALUES IN PILOT ADS Hunting Season Change Proposed; Meeting Scheduled Tarheel quail, rabbit and wild turkey hunters will get a fourday bonus for hunting this year if sportsmen throughout the state go along with a proposal by the Wildlife Commission to open the season on these species November 17 instead of the traditional Thanksgiving Day opening that would fall on November 22. The proposed season would run through February 16. Last year’s season ended February 15. The reason given for the pro posed earlier opening date is that hunters would get a chance to harvest game earlier in the season that would otherwise be lost through natural mortality. Other than the earlier opening for quail, rabbits and wild turkey, the Wildlife Commission is pro posing only minor changes in hunting dates in the nature of calendar adjustments. Bag limits on all species would remain un changed. In response to requests from archers the Commission proposes to schedule three days of archery hunts on the Sandhills Wildlife Management Area. Prosposed hunting regulation will be presented to the public in a series of meetings over the State. The District 6 meeting, for this area, will be held at the courthouse in Albemarle at 7:30 p.m., Friday, May 18. Fifty-four million people live in rural areas in the U. PLASTIC GREENHOUSES Mushrooming interest in the use of plastic-covered structures for growing plants in North Carolina has resulted in a new publication by the N.' C. Agricul- tiural Exterision Service at State College. Titled “Plastic Green houses,” the circular is designed to summarize the latest recom mendations on construction, heat ing and ventilation. Free copies may be obtained from county agripultural agents or by writing directly to the De partment of Agricultural Infor mation at N. C. State College, Raleigh.
